diff --git a/README.mkd b/README.mkd index efbd559..5fea55c 100644 --- a/README.mkd +++ b/README.mkd @@ -23,9 +23,8 @@ Features: Constraints: -* Supports git only. - -If you work with other version control systems, I recommend [vim-signify](https://github.com/mhinz/vim-signify). +* Supports git only. If you work with other version control systems, I recommend [vim-signify](https://github.com/mhinz/vim-signify). +* Relies on the `FocusGained` event. If your terminal doesn't report focus events, I suggest using something like [Terminus][]. ### Screenshot @@ -505,6 +504,10 @@ Here are some things you can check: * Try reducing `updatetime`, e.g. `set updatetime=100`. +#### When signs don't update after focusing Vim + +* Your terminal probably isn't reporting focus events. Try installing [Terminus][]. + ### Shameless Plug @@ -525,3 +528,4 @@ Copyright Andrew Stewart, AirBlade Software Ltd. Released under the MIT licence [pathogen]: https://github.com/tpope/vim-pathogen [siv]: http://pluralsight.com/training/Courses/TableOfContents/smash-into-vim [airblade]: http://airbladesoftware.com/peepcode-vim + [terminus]: https://github.com/wincent/terminus diff --git a/doc/gitgutter.txt b/doc/gitgutter.txt index 379383d..d7aefb6 100644 --- a/doc/gitgutter.txt +++ b/doc/gitgutter.txt @@ -488,3 +488,9 @@ Try reducing 'updatetime': set updatetime=100 < + +When signs don't update after focusing Vim:~ + +Your terminal probably isn't reporting focus events. Try installing Terminus +(https://github.com/wincent/terminus). +